This collection of papers is concerned with the ecology and occupation of mountain areas. Focusing especially on ecological problems in these areas, its theme is an outgrowth of "Man and the Biosphere," a fledgling international program sponsored by UNESCO. The book is particularly concerned with section 6 of the UNESCO program, "Impact of Human Activities on Temperate and Tropical Mountain and Tundra Ecosystems." Each of the contributing authors is an internationally recognized authority, and each has provided a review of the state of knowledge and a discussion of special problems and areas for future research in his or her field of specialization.
Foreword -- Introduction and Commentary -- Applied High Altitude Geoecology -- Monitoring and Mapping Mountain Environments -- High Altitude Climates -- Ice and Snow at High Altitudes -- High Mountain Ecosystems -- High Altitude Physiology -- Effects of Change on High Mountain Human Adaptive Patterns
